流媒体CDN如何实现加速?

在当今的数字环境中,流媒体CDN技术彻底改变了我们在全球范围内传输视频内容的方式。随着视频流媒体需求持续激增,了解CDN加速对于管理美国服务器租用基础设施的技术专业人员来说变得至关重要。预计到2025年,全球视频流量将占据所有互联网流量的82%,这突显了高效内容分发网络的重要性。本综合指南探讨了流媒体CDN加速背后的前沿机制及其在现代服务器租用环境中的实际应用。
流媒体CDN的技术基础
从本质上讲,流媒体CDN基于分布式网络架构运行,突破了传统内容分发的限制。与传统的服务器租用解决方案不同,流媒体CDN采用先进的边缘计算算法,在全球战略位置处理和缓存内容。这种架构通过减少内容与最终用户之间的物理距离来最小化延迟。与传统的服务器租用方法相比,现代CDN可以实现高达60%的内容分发速度提升。
流媒体CDN加速背后的基本原理在于其分布式架构。CDN不是从单一源服务器提供内容,而是利用战略性地分布在不同地理位置的互联服务器网络。这种分布确保用户从最近的可用服务器接收内容,显著降低延迟并提高整体性能。
边缘节点分布架构
现代流媒体CDN利用战略性布置在关键互联网交换点的复杂边缘节点网络。这些节点作为智能缓存系统运行,实施先进的内容优化和分发算法。边缘计算范式通过将处理能力带到更接近最终用户的位置,彻底改变了内容分发方式。
边缘节点架构的关键组件包括:
1. 动态内容复制
– 基于需求模式的自动内容分发
– 热门内容智能预加载
– 区域内容流行度分析
– 自适应缓存管理系统
2. 实时流量路由
– 高级负载均衡算法
– 地理流量分配
– 网络状况监控
– 动态路径优化
3. 预测性内容定位
– 基于机器学习的需求预测
– 用户行为分析
– 内容流行度预测
– 自动资源分配
4. 自动故障转移机制
– 冗余节点部署
– 健康监控系统
– 即时故障转移路由
– 高可用性架构
协议优化和性能工程
CDN加速高度依赖于对流媒体性能有显著影响的协议级优化。现代流媒体CDN实施复杂的协议工程技术,与标准实现相比可将延迟降低多达40%。
1. TCP/IP协议栈优化
– 使用机器学习的自定义拥塞控制算法
– 基于网络状况的动态数据包大小调整(范围从1.4KB到64KB)
– 多路径TCP实现以提高可靠性
– TCP快速打开支持,减少连接建立时间15-40%
– 高级缓冲区管理技术
2. 应用层协议
– WebRTC实现亚秒级延迟流媒体
– 支持HTTP/3和QUIC,提供25%更快的连接建立
– 具有改进错误恢复功能的增强型RTMP变体
– 基于客户端能力的自适应协议选择
– 用于实时数据传输的WebSocket优化
智能DNS解析系统
DNS基础设施作为高效内容路由的基石,将用户引导至最佳边缘服务器。现代流媒体CDN实施先进的DNS技术,可将解析时间减少高达70%。
主要DNS优化功能包括:
1. Anycast路由协议
– 全局服务器负载均衡(GSLB)
– 亚秒级收敛的自动故障转移
– BGP路由优化
– 多区域DNS部署
2. GeoDNS技术
– 位置感知请求路由
– 区域流量管理
– 基于延迟的服务器选择
– 基于用户人口统计的自定义路由策略
3. 基于健康检查的故障转移
– 实时服务器健康监控
– 自动DNS记录更新
– 主动故障检测
– 恢复时间目标(RTO)小于30秒
4. 负载均衡解析
– 动态权重分配
– 流量分配算法
– 峰值负载管理
– 资源利用率优化
高级视频处理技术
现代流媒体CDN中的视频处理能力采用尖端技术,在保持质量的同时优化传输。这些系统可以减少高达50%的带宽消耗,同时改善观看体验。
1. 自适应比特率流媒体(ABR)
– 基于网络状况的动态质量调整
– 多比特率编码(通常6-8种变体)
– 具有预测算法的客户端缓冲区管理
– 体验质量(QoE)监控和优化
– 针对最佳观看体验的分段自适应
2. 视频分段和传输
– 减小分段大小的HLS优化
– 具有动态适应的DASH实现
– 基于分块的传输优化
– 多编解码器支持(H.264、H.265、AV1)
– 实时转码能力
3. 高级缓存机制
– 多层缓存架构
– 内容感知缓存策略
– 智能预取算法
– 缓存一致性协议
– 动态TTL管理
安全实现
现代CDN加速整合了强大的安全措施,在保持最佳传输速度的同时保护内容。多层安全方法确保性能和保护兼具。
1. DDoS缓解
– 高达100 Tbps的第3/4层攻击防护
– 应用层(第7层)过滤
– 速率限制和流量分析
– 高级机器人检测机制
– 实时威胁情报集成
2. 访问控制和身份验证
– 支持JWT的基于令牌的身份验证
– 基于IP的访问控制列表
– 地理位置阻止功能
– 引用来源和用户代理验证
– 自定义安全规则实现
3. 加密和协议安全
– 支持具有0-RTT的TLS 1.3
– 自定义SSL/TLS证书管理
– 完美前向保密(PFS)
– HSTS实现
– 安全令牌生成和验证
性能指标和监控
有效的CDN加速需要全面的监控和分析系统,提供实时性能指标洞察。现代流媒体CDN通常通过严格的监控维持99.99%的正常运行时间保证。
1. 核心性能指标
– 边缘服务器响应时间(目标<100ms)
– 跨区域网络延迟指标
– 缓存命中率(最优>90%)
– 带宽使用模式
– 错误率和源站回源统计
2. 高级分析
– 实时流媒体分析
– 观众参与度指标
– 体验质量(QoE)评分
– 地理分布分析
– 峰值并发观众跟踪
3. 监控系统
– 端到端性能监控
– 实时告警系统
– 用于容量规划的预测分析
– 自定义指标跟踪
– 历史趋势分析
美国服务器租用集成最佳实践
为了在美国服务器租用环境中实现最佳的流媒体CDN性能,实施适当的集成策略至关重要。这些最佳实践可以提高内容传输效率达40%。
1. 源站服务器配置
– 配置源站拉取优化
– 实施适当的缓存控制标头
– 启用压缩算法(Brotli/Gzip)
– 设置多个故障转移路径
– 优化源站响应时间
2. 网络架构
– 战略性利用区域边缘节点
– 实施冗余网络路径
– 配置BGP路由策略
– 优化对等互联关系
– 部署Anycast DNS架构
3. 内容优化
– 实施自适应比特率流媒体
– 配置内容版本控制
– 启用动态压缩
– 优化媒体分段
– 配置预加载策略
4. 性能调优
– 微调缓存设置
– 优化SSL/TLS配置
– 配置带宽限制
– 实施请求合并
– 启用HTTP/2和HTTP/3支持
未来发展和趋势
流媒体CDN领域持续快速发展,新兴技术正在重塑内容传输能力。了解这些趋势对于在美国服务器租用市场保持竞争优势至关重要。
1. 边缘计算增强
– 边缘位置的无服务器计算
– 增强的处理能力
– 实时视频处理
– 基于边缘的机器学习
– 自定义边缘应用部署
2. AI驱动的内容分发
– 预测性内容放置
– 自动质量优化
– 动态资源分配
– 用户行为分析
– 智能路由决策
3. 5G网络集成
– 超低延迟流媒体(<10ms)
– 移动边缘计算(MEC)
– 网络切片支持
– 增强移动流媒体
– 5G带宽优化
4. 高级协议开发
– QUIC协议采用
– WebTransport实现
– 新型流媒体协议
– 增强的安全措施
– 改进的拥塞控制
实施挑战和解决方案
虽然流媒体CDN技术提供显著优势,但组织必须应对几个关键挑战:
1. 成本管理
– 带宽优化策略
– 流量预测模型
– 资源分配效率
– 多CDN负载均衡
– 峰值流量处理
2. 技术集成
– API兼容性
– 源站服务器集成
– 配置管理
– 性能监控
– 安全实施
3. 质量保证
– 持续测试方法
– 性能基准测试
– 错误处理程序
– 自动化监控
– 质量指标跟踪
投资回报率和性能指标
了解流媒体CDN实施的投资回报至关重要:
– 平均延迟降低:40-60%
– 带宽成本节省:30-50%
– 缓存命中率提升:高达95%
– 用户参与度增加:25-35%
– 客户满意度提升:40%
结论
随着流媒体需求持续呈指数级增长,CDN加速技术仍然是通过美国服务器租用基础设施传输高质量内容的基础。AI、边缘计算和5G网络等先进技术的整合正在重塑流媒体CDN格局,为性能优化和用户体验提升提供前所未有的机遇。
利用流媒体CDN的组织必须保持对这些技术进步和最佳实践的了解,以在快速发展的数字环境中保持竞争优势。通过适当的实施和优化,流媒体CDN技术可以显著提升内容传输能力,同时降低成本并提高用户满意度。
流媒体CDN技术的未来展望光明,边缘计算、AI和协议优化方面的持续创新将引领发展方向。展望未来,重点将继续放在通过先进的流媒体CDN和美国服务器租用基础设施,为全球用户提供更快、更可靠、更安全的内容传输。